Output 63c3b93ffdb5f784f1076a32ab6ce2b50b402b5482234552d3c3c1726bf52c83:0

value
99000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 aba24898f0c9dfb044bb43e615f67a02aef1390f OP_EQUAL
address
3HLXt1Qaa56kgDcdLSEeRxF2VmtnHHTWNo
transaction
63c3b93ffdb5f784f1076a32ab6ce2b50b402b5482234552d3c3c1726bf52c83